Distance from Port-Alfred to Chatham

The straight-line distance between Port-Alfred and Chatham is 436.2 km. The estimated road distance by car is around 493 km, with an indicative drive time of 5 h 29 min.

Straight-line distance 436.2 km
Estimated road distance ~493 km
Indicative drive time 5 h 29 min
Note: values are approximate estimates. Road distance is calculated by multiplying the straight-line distance by a road-deviation factor (1.13–1.30 based on length). Drive time assumes ~90 km/h average. Real traffic, tolls, and conditions can vary significantly. Use the live planner for current data.

Practical tips for the Port-Alfred – Chatham drive

Terrain along the way

The route starts in Quebec — a province St. Lawrence valley framed by the Laurentians and the Appalachians — and reaches Chatham in New Brunswick, forested and Acadian, with the Bay of Fundy and tidal coastlines. The route also passes near Edmundston (New Brunswick).

When to leave

For a long route, leave early (before 06:30) or wait until after 10:00. Avoid summer long-weekend exoduses and major holidays. Plan a break every 1.5–2 hours of driving — and check weather, especially across the Prairies and through mountain passes.

Does the Port-Alfred–Chatham route involve highway tolls?

CanadaDrivingDirections.com does not provide toll details. Toll roads are limited in Canada — Ontario's 407 ETR, a few Quebec bridges, and the Confederation Bridge to PEI are the main ones. Check the operator's site for current pricing.
